What's Next for ZEC in 2026?

Regulatory clarity remains pivotal for ZEC's sustained momentum. While privacy assets face compliance headwinds,

could mitigate concerns. The token's technical architecture enables view keys for auditing purposes, balancing anonymity with regulatory needs. This design may position it favorably as crypto regulations mature globally in 2026.

Market participants should monitor ETF developments and on-chain metrics. Bitwise's privacy ETF could launch as early as Q1 2026 if approved.
